Same as Beale Street in San Francisco....Edward F. Beale, a Lieutenant in the Navy (which is unusual in itself) in 1848 war with Mexico. most famous as an engineer and surveyor for building the Beale Road across the southwest to California from New Mexico using Camels in one part of it ( now old route 66) ...also was the first to send word back to Washington D.C. of the Sutter gold mine strike in California of 1848-starting the gold rush of 1849. Had amazing political and family connections at that time. May have tie-ins with the legendary Beale Treasure Code out of Virginia, but unknown. In fact all of this is " unknown", since most stories about Memphis Beale street say it was named after a forgotten or unknown Mexican War hero---but this is the only Mexican War" hero " out there named Beale, and was obviously well known in his day.
